Key Responsibilities
- Independently manage approximately $2 million-$3 million in annual telecom construction revenue across multiple active sites.
- Own customer communication, project financials, forecasting, scheduling, billing, change management, quality, and project closeout.
- Coordinate Construction Managers, Project Coordinators, subcontractors, and vendors across tower, civil, DC, modifications, new-site builds, and telecom construction scopes.
- Build and maintain project budgets while reviewing costs against purchase orders and protecting project margins.
- Direct Project Coordinators and Construction Managers by setting priorities, reviewing project trackers, and removing obstacles.
- Solicit, evaluate, and negotiate subcontractor and vendor pricing while preparing purchase orders and scopes of work.
- Track project milestones, permitting, utility coordination, long-lead materials, and customer deliverables to keep projects on schedule.
- Price and process change orders while ensuring customer purchase orders are received before additional work begins.
- Ensure crews submit required documentation, project photos, testing records, and closeout packages accurately and on time.
- Provide proactive project updates to customers, leadership, and internal teams while communicating risks and recovery plans.
